What Are The Benefits of Sourcing Domestic Custom-Engineered Transformers?
Domestic sourcing of custom-engineered transformers eliminates a wide range of hidden costs and logistical risks. Partnering with an American manufacturer provides the following benefits:
Reduced Inventory Carrying Costs: International orders typically require full-container minimums and tie up working capital for months. Domestic suppliers work with smaller order volumes that align with production schedules.
Intellectual Property (IP) Security: US manufacturing operates under strict federal laws that protect proprietary designs, whereas sharing schematics with overseas vendors increases the risk of IP theft and unauthorized reproduction.
Streamlined Engineering Collaboration: Custom projects require frequent technical back-and-forth to ensure specifications are met. Domestic suppliers allow for real-time communication and troubleshooting of complex design constraints without language barriers or delays.
Rapid Prototyping and Iteration: Validating a custom design often requires testing physical units before full production. Working with a U.S.-based manufacturer allows for prototype delivery much faster than overseas shipping and enables much faster design adjustments.

Which Industries Require Custom-Engineered Components?
Companies specify custom-engineered transformers when off-the-shelf ones cannot meet their exact performance criteria. These requirements range from federal compliance mandates to operational reliability concerns.
Industries that depend on custom transformers include:
Medical and X-Ray Equipment: FDA regulations and UL 60601 standards require documented component traceability and manufacturing provenance for patient safety devices.
Professional Audio: Studio-grade equipment requires precision magnetic components with tight tolerances and minimal harmonic distortion that offshore manufacturers struggle to deliver consistently.
Energy and Oil Exploration: Grid operators and drilling contractors avoid foreign-manufactured components to reduce cybersecurity vulnerabilities and meet federal procurement guidelines for critical infrastructure.
Gaming and Commercial Electronics: High-volume production environments require transformer consistency across batches to prevent field failures and warranty claims that undermine profitability.
Industrial Manufacturing: Automation systems and production equipment depend on transformers that maintain specifications under continuous operation without the quality drift common in imported components.

Reduce Lead Times with American-Made Transformers
Lead times for offshore transformers typically range from 12 to 20 weeks due to ocean freight and customs clearance. American manufacturers deliver in a fraction of that time by eliminating international shipping.
Multiple factors contribute to the timeline differences between domestic and offshore transformer procurement:
Ocean Freight Duration: Container shipments from Asia to US ports take 30 to 45 days before customs processing begins. Delays at congested ports can add another two weeks.
Customs and Inspection: Import documentation, duty assessment, and physical inspections add 5 to 10 business days to the procurement cycle. Errors in paperwork extend this further.
Domestic Ground Transport: American manufacturers ship via truck or rail with typical domestic delivery times. Expedited freight options reach most locations within 48 hours.
Production Schedule Visibility: Local suppliers provide real-time updates on order status and production progress. Time zone differences of 12+ hours can delay responses to important technical questions and order updates.
Rush Order Capability: Domestic facilities can prioritize urgent orders and adjust production schedules within days. International orders cannot be accelerated once containers are loaded.
